ANNUAL AWARDS CEREMONY

New Masters of Wine are announced twice a year, in February/March and in August/September. The new crop for that year is then officially welcomed to the IMW membership at the annual awards ceremony in November. The occasion, which takes place at Vintners’ Hall, London, celebrates the inauguration of the new MWs and recognises individual excellence in areas of the MW exam. Masters of Wine from around the globe fly into London for the occasion to welcome the new ‘MW vintage’.

AWARD WINNERS

Individual awards were first introduced to the ceremony in 1979. Over the years, the awards have been sponsored by IMW supporters and our friends in the wine trade.

Villa Maria Award
For the best viticulture paper
1994-present

Robert Mondavi Award
For best performance in the theory papers
1997-present

Quinta do Noval Award
For the best research paper (previously dissertation)
2001-present

Taransaud Tonnellerie Award
For excellence in the production and handling of wine paper
2010-present

IMW Outstanding Achievement Award
Sponsored by the Austrian Wine Marketing Board
2009-present

Chair’s Award
For the top performance in the business of wine paper
2019-present

Errazuriz Award
For the best overall result in the business of wine paper
1999-2018

Tim Derouet Memorial
Foundation Award
For the best overall exam result
1979-2008

Safeway Award
For excellence in the marketing paper
1992-1996

J. Sainsbury Plc Award
For an outstanding dissertation
1994-1999

Robert Oatley Bursary
For the best essay
1994-1999

Domaines Listel Award
For the best vinification paper 
1994-1997

Tesco Award
For the best quality control/quality assurance paper 
1996-2007

The Deinhard Award
For an outstanding dissertation
2002-2003
